Arjun Publishing House Liberalisation and Development Agenda for Economic Reforms by Vijaya Nambiar
In a country like India, which has an enormous amount of investment in public sector enterprises, the reforms under liberalisation have largely been focused in the direction of selective privatisation, graduation removal of state monopoly in key financial areas such as banking and insurance, and the removal of restrictions on import from the developed coutnries.
